CLAIMED DESTRUCTION OF RUSSIAN TOS-2 "TOSOCHKA" (REPORTED, RBC-Ukraine, citing OSINT): (13:21, 13:38 UTC) OSINT analysts report the first confirmed loss of a Russian TOS-2 "Tosochka" 220mm thermobaric multiple rocket launcher system in the Pokrovsk direction. Defense Express suggests it was destroyed by fiber-optic guided FPV drones. Images of the destroyed vehicle are circulating.
Assessment:HIGHLY SIGNIFICANT DEVELOPMENT, REQUIRES FURTHER VERIFICATION. If confirmed, this represents the FIRST DOCUMENTED LOSS of this new and powerful Russian weapon system.
